The fruit of the Silene stenophylla specifically date to about 32,000 years ago in the Pleistocene epoch. Radiocarbon dating was used by scientists to assess the age of the batch of mature and immature seeds recovered from the permafrost. Back in 2012, the team of Russian researchers broke new ground when they regenerated a series of Silene stenophylla plants from 32,000-year-old seed pods, sharing their . The fascinating variegated ornamental foliage comes reasonably true from seed. The Russian team's theory is that the tissue cells are full of sucrose that would have formed food for the growing plants.
